
The NorthShore Inline Marathon, hosted each September along the breathtaking shores of Lake Superior from Two Harbors to Duluth, is a premier multi-sport endurance event and community celebration. While it is best known as the world’s largest point-to-point inline skating race, the festival also highlights an impressive running program with the Aspirus St. Luke’s Half Marathon and the Finden Marketing Tunnel 10K Run, attracting runners of all levels. Inline skaters can choose from the full marathon, half marathon, Tunnel 10K, or the challenging 39.3-mile combined skate, while rollerskiers test themselves in the full and half marathon events. Families and youth are included in the excitement with free kids’ sprints, and the weekend also features an expo, community gatherings, and scenic racing through iconic Duluth landmarks like the I-35 tunnels. Together, these events make the NorthShore Inline Marathon & Skate Fest a one-of-a-kind celebration of fitness, endurance, and the North Shore spirit.

The Aspirus St. Luke’s Half Marathon, held each September along Minnesota’s scenic North Shore, is a premier long-distance running event that challenges participants with a 13.1-mile route from Two Harbors to Duluth. Known for its beautiful lakefront views and well-organized course, it attracts runners of all levels looking for a memorable half-marathon experience.
The Finden Marketing Tunnel 10K is a scenic 6.2-mile road race held each September along Minnesota’s North Shore, featuring a unique route that passes through the iconic I-35 tunnels near Duluth. Popular with runners of all abilities, the event combines a fast, well-marked course with stunning lakefront and forest views
